Career
Born in the Netherlands, Lilipaly represented his country of birth at youth level Lilipaly made his debut for the Indonesia national team in 2013. Lilipaly played for Dutch amateur side RKSV DCG for three years before joining Eredivisie club Arizona"s academy in 2000.
He moved to Utrecht the following year and progressed through their youth system.
Lilipaly made his first team debut for Utrecht in a league game at VVV-Venlo in August 2011, and his first appearance in the starting eleven came in January 2012, where he scored the opening goal against PSV. He played five times for Utrecht before joining Eerste Divisie club Almere City on a free transfer in the summer of 2012. On December 17, 2014, it was reported that he have agreed to join Persija.
Lilipaly represented the Netherlands at youth level, from the under-15s to under-18s. With little opportunity of playing for the Netherlands, Lilipaly took the Indonesian citizenship oath in October 2011, alongside four other players, to make him officially available for selection.
He made his full international debut in August 2013 against the Philippines.
